# Qwen3.8-27B Abliterated — MTPLX Optimized Speed

**Qwen3.8 was created by the Qwen team. This is a derivative conversion, not a
PocketAI-created base model.** PocketAiHub performed a refusal-direction orthogonal projection on 80 language residual-output tensors, then converted and validated the result.

Built with **[MTPLX 2.7.1](https://github.com/youssofal/MTPLX)** from
[`Qwen/Qwen3.8-27B`](https://huggingface.co/Qwen/Qwen3.8-27B) at revision
`1d4bf0f2ff6012fd82039f2fa52739d0dd7c60c0`. The mixed-precision layout follows
[`Youssofal/Qwen3.8-27B-MTPLX-Optimized-Speed`](https://huggingface.co/Youssofal/Qwen3.8-27B-MTPLX-Optimized-Speed): bulk 4-bit/group
32, embeddings + LM head + GDN output projections + final eight MLP blocks at
8-bit/group 64, sensitive state/norm tensors and the native MTP head in BF16.

## Measured performance

Apple M5 Max (40-core GPU, 128 GB unified memory), macOS 26.4, single stream,
Apple automatic fan control. These are measurements on this exact artifact,
not universal hardware guarantees.

| Mode | Decode tok/s | End-to-end tok/s | Speedup vs AR | Acceptance by depth |
|---|---:|---:|---:|---|
| AR | 24.74 | 24.28 | 1.00× | — |
| D1 | 41.55 | 40.53 | 1.68× | 95.6% |
| D2 | 51.55 | 49.70 | 2.08× | 97.9%, 91.6% |
| D3 | 58.05 | 56.01 | **2.35×** | 96.3%, 88.8%, 80.6% |

The controlled tune used official Qwen3.8 sampling, thinking disabled, up to
1,024 generated tokens, and selected D3. Download payload: 21.31 GB.

### 4K context

The prompt contained 4,099 formatted tokens with `COBALT-7319` at 59.9% depth.
AR and D3 both returned exactly `COBALT-7319`; greedy outputs were identical.

| Mode | Prefill tok/s | Decode tok/s | Prompt eval | Peak process RSS | Peak footprint |
|---|---:|---:|---:|---:|---:|
| AR | 602.4 | 26.4 | 6.80s | 20.9 GB | 24.9 GB |
| D3 | 615.2 | 58.4 | 6.66s | 20.9 GB | 29.0 GB |

The 4K response contained only nine generated tokens, so decode tok/s is more
informative than its end-to-end generation rate.

## KL divergence

PocketAiHub measured **mean forward KL 0.30906 nats** for regular MTPLX → abliterated MTPLX at matched quantization (median 0.01142, p95 1.61390, top-1 agreement 85.94%). The capability-prompt mean was 0.05640; the harmful-prompt mean was 0.56171. This isolates additional abliteration drift by comparing checkpoints with the same MTPLX quantization layout. The official 0.0220 value measures a different quantization comparison and must not be reused as the abliteration KL.

Method: 24 prompts (12 capability + 12 pinned JailbreakBench harmful), 16
BF16-greedy teacher-forced assistant positions per prompt, 384 positions total,
all 248,320 vocabulary logits, float32 capture and float64 probability math.
Direction is `D_KL(P_reference || P_candidate)` in nats. Full per-suite and
per-case aggregates are in `evaluation/kl-summary.json`.
